html – iOS Safari 8输入溢出滚动

前端之家收集整理的这篇文章主要介绍了html – iOS Safari 8输入溢出滚动前端之家小编觉得挺不错的,现在分享给大家,也给大家做个参考。
我在移动Safari,版本8.1上的表单字段有问题.这似乎是所有版本的Safari 8在移动设备上的错误.

当您将文本输入到输入中,并且该文本的长度大于输入本身时,光标在输入时会继续向右移动 – 这是正确的.问题是当您按住选择并尝试向左移动到隐藏的文本时,您无法滚动.同样,如果您在输入外部选择,则无法向右滚动以查看隐藏的文本.

您唯一的选择是选择所有和删除.

这个问题的任何解决方法?我已经上传了一个具有不同输入类型的示例页面,其中的所有行为都存在.

小提琴:http://jsfiddle.net/b7kmxaL6/(访问移动Safari)

<form action="">
    <fieldset>
        <input type="text" class="text">
        <input type="email" class="email">
        <input type="password" class="password">
    </fieldset>
</form>

解决方法

在我正在编码移动设备的网络应用中,我看到同样的问题.

如果您将网站添加到主屏幕,然后使用< Meta name =“apple-mobile-web-app-capable”content =“yes”>在头部,然后问题不显示:您现在可以通过在输入字段的边缘移动插入符号向左或向右滚动浏览输入文本.

原文链接:https://www.f2er.com/html/228111.html

猜你在找的HTML相关文章